概括
异种移植,使用动物器官,如猪脏用于人类,是器官短缺的潜在解决方案. 基因编辑的进步改善了结果,但病毒传播和伦理等挑战仍然存在.

Kidney Structure
75.0K
The kidneys are two large bean-shaped organs located in the upper abdomen. They filter the blood several times a day to remove toxins and rebalance water and electrolytes of the circulatory system via the renal veins. The kidneys receive blood directly from the heart via the renal arteries. These arteries enter the kidney at the hilum, the concave surface of the bean, where they branch and divide into smaller vessels and capillaries.
